Clos19 personalization Studio at Grand Central

  Moët Hennessy’s Clos19 online retail and lifestyle platform announces the debut of the Holiday Personalization Studio at Grand Central Terminal New York. The studio will offer the opportunity to customize products from Moët Hennessy’s iconic brands featuring Ardbeg, Glenmorangie, Hennessy, Veuve Clicquot and Moët & Chandon. The world’s leading luxury group recorded a 10% increase of sales revenue despite unfavorable currency environment

  The world’s leading luxury products group, recorded revenue of €21.8 billion in the first half of 2018, an increase of 10%. LVMH reports strong growth in Asia and the United States,  a good start to the year for Wines and Spirits, excellent performance of Bvlgari, and a good performance of watch brands.
